Cup Diameter
The Bach 1B has a cup diameter of 17.00 mm / 0.6693 in compared to 16.30 mm / 0.6417 in on the Monette Cornet BP3F rim — a difference of 0.70 mm / 0.0276 in. A wider cup generally produces a fuller, darker tone but requires more air support.
Cup Depth
Both mouthpieces share a deep cup depth, so the sound character from depth alone will be very similar.
Throat Diameter
Throat diameters are essentially identical at 3.66 mm / 0.1441 in, so resistance feel will be comparable.
